Requirements:
None. Anyone may participate. No qualifying is necessary and all abilities are welcome.
Course:
The course will cover 6-8 miles of diverse and challenging terrain.
No special skills will be required,
but some dirt under the nails is likely. There will be some significant elevation gain and loss.
There MAY be one official aid station on the course (weatherand access permitting) - it will be located as close to the half-way mark as possible. If
you think you will need aid... carry it.
Awards:
Awards will be given to the top finisher in each age group (14 &Under, 15-19 and then up in 5 year intervals. Men and women).
Overall awards and top masters awards will also be given. The awards ceremony will be at Timberline Lodge at 12:30 PM.
TEAMS
Team
awards will be given to the top men's, women's, and mixed team. Teams will consist of three
members . Scoring will be based on cumulative time.

About Timberline Lodge and the venue on the Mt. Hood:
The lodge and the event start at 6,000'. There are more than 1,000 acres of terrain at Timberline,
including
4,000' of vertical options. The ski area and biggest slopes in the Northwest will set the course
up as one of the best mountain runs in the US. Terrain will include slopes, trails, skid roads, and any other shaggy
deemed as worthy. |
